On time performance of domestic airlines improving: DGCA
New Delhi, Aug 26 - The Directorate General of Civil Aviation - Thursday said there has been a significant improvement in on time performances - of domestic airlines.According to DGCA, in the national capital the OTP has risen from 15-20 percent to 50-60 percent while in Mumbai it has risen from 40-50 percent to 70-75 percent and in other airports it is between 90 to 92 percent. 3,516 avail visa on arrival facility till July
New Delhi, Aug 9 - A total of 3,516 visitors availed the Visa on Arrival - scheme of the government, intended to attract more foreign tourists to India, between January and July, officials said Monday.This scheme, launched January this year, was applicable for citizens of Finland, Japan, Luxembourg, New Zealand and Singapore, visiting India for tourism purposes.
